Teste escrito do programador: teste Didi 2021 e coleção de perguntas de escolha única do engenheiro de desenvolvimento (8)

1. A descrição do algoritmo euclidiano (GCD) está incorreta. ()
A. Se GCD (a, b) = 0, então a e b
são relativamente primos B. O algoritmo euclidiano também é chamado de jogadas e voltas A divisão é um método para encontrar o máximo divisor comum.
C. A implementação do algoritmo Euclidiano pode ser realizada por recursão.
D. A complexidade de tempo do algoritmo Euclidiano é (logn)

2. Suponha que quando um aluno usa o modelo de classificação Bayesiano, devido a uma operação incorreta, as duas dimensões nos dados de treinamento se repetem. A seguinte descrição está correta ()
A. Se todas as características forem repetidas, o resultado da previsão não ocorrerá Mudança
B. A precisão do efeito do modelo é reduzida
C. Os outros itens não são verdadeiros
D. A função repetida no modelo é reforçada

3. O cronograma das universidades para idosos é o seguinte: as aulas de piano acontecem durante todo o dia na segunda e quinta de manhã, as aulas de ioga são na terça de manhã e quinta à tarde, as aulas de caligrafia são na terça à tarde e quarta pela manhã, e as aulas de pintura chinesa são o dia todo sexta e quarta à tarde. Sabendo que na manhã de 2 de junho 20X0 é uma aula de ioga, e na tarde de 5 de janeiro, 20X1 é uma aula ()
A. Pintura chinesa
B. Piano
C. Yoga
D. Caligrafia

4. Os campos que atendem às seguintes condições podem ser usados ​​para criar um índice ()
A. Campos com alterações frequentes no conteúdo
B. Campos que não serão usados ​​na instrução where
C. Campos com alta repetição
D. Campos frequentemente usados ​​como condições de consulta

5. A seguinte descrição do processo de uso do LoadRunner para teste de desempenho está correta ()
A. Escrevendo planos de teste de desempenho- "cenários de execução-" scripts de gravação- "scripts de otimização-" analisando dados de teste de desempenho - "escrevendo relatório resumido
B. Redação) Plano de Teste de Desempenho- "Gravação de Script-" Cenário de Execução- "Otimizar Script-" Analisar Dados de Teste de Desempenho- "Gravar Relatório de Resumo
C. Gravar Plano de Teste de Desempenho-" Cenário de Execução- "Gravar Script-" Analisar Dados de Teste de Desempenho- "Otimizar Script - "Compilar relatório de resumo
D. Escrever plano de teste de desempenho-" Gravar script- "Otimizar script -" Cenário de execução- "Analisar dados de teste de desempenho -" Escrever relatório de resumo

6. Insira a descrição da imagem aqui
A. Figura B
B. Figura A
C. Figura C
D. Figura D

7. Com a expansão dos campos de aplicativos de software, a compatibilidade do software com diferentes arquiteturas é particularmente importante. A seguinte descrição de compatibilidade está correta () (múltipla escolha)
A. Teste se o software é compatível com outro software relacionado na mesma plataforma
B. Condições de execução sob diferentes periféricos e diferentes interfaces
C. Um dos focos do teste de compatibilidade é se o próprio software pode ser compatível com versões anteriores ou posteriores
D. O teste de configuração é um teste de compatibilidade

8. Suponha que haja uma certa célula que se divide de uma em três células-filhas a cada cinco minutos e que as células-filhas também podem sofrer a mesma divisão. Agora que sabemos que existe um total de x células-filhas após y minutos, encontre o número mínimo de células inicialmente. Os métodos a seguir são inadequados ()
A. Empurre a fórmula
B. Greedy
C. Enumere
D. Dicotomia

9. Há um trecho da estrada com 1.500 metros de comprimento e uma lata de lixo é colocada em cada extremidade da estrada. Ao mesmo tempo, há uma lata de lixo a cada 20 metros no meio. É necessário montar uma caixa de lixo a cada 15 metros, incluindo as duas extremidades. Há um total de () latas de lixo sem mover
A.51
B.50
C.25
D.26

10. As operações de inserção e exclusão da pilha são realizadas em ()
A. A parte inferior da pilha
B. A posição designada
C. A parte superior da pilha
D. Qualquer posição

11. Se o comprimento de uma tabela de sequência for n, então quando um elemento com um valor de x for encontrado na tabela de sequência da tabela, no caso de probabilidade igual, o número médio de comparações de dados bem-sucedidos é ()
An / 2
B. (n -1) / 2
C. (n + 1) / 2
Dn

12. Existem as seguintes definições de
classe ponto de classe
{ int x, y; público: ponto (int v1, int v2) {x = v1; y = v2;) operador de ponto * = (int i) {x * = i; y * = i; retornar isso;} int GetX () {retornar x;} int GetY () {retornar y;} }; então, o erro de sintaxe na instrução a seguir é () (múltipla escolha) ponto a (2,3); // 1 a.operator = (3); // 2 a * = 3; // 3 3 * = a; // 4 3.operator (a); // 5 A.5 B.4 C.2 D .1,3
















13. 下述 程序 输出 为 ()
#include <bits / stdc ++. H>
using namespace std;
int C [15] [15];
int main () { memset (C, 0, sizeof ©); for (int i = 1; i <= 10; ++ i) { for (int j = 1; j <= i; ++ j) { if (j == 1) { C [i] [j] = Eu; } else { C [i] [j] = C [i-1] [j] + C [i-1] [j-1]; } } } cout << C [8] [3] << endl; return 0; } A.48 B.56 C.72 D.64

















14. Na seguinte descrição da árvore binária, o correto é ()
A. O valor-chave de cada nó na árvore binária é maior do que o valor-chave de todos os nós em sua subárvore não vazia à esquerda (se existir) e é menor que seu valor não vazio à direita O valor-chave de todos os nós da subárvore vazia (se existir)
B. Se a árvore binária usa uma lista binária vinculada como estrutura de armazenamento, há apenas n + 1 domínios de ponteiro não nulos na lista vinculada da árvore binária de n nós
. C. Por pré-ordem Seqüência e seqüência pós-ordem podem determinar uma árvore binária
D. Uma árvore binária com profundidade k tem no máximo 2 ^ k-1 nós (k> = 1)

15. No método de divisão de classe de equivalência, os testes de aprovação e reprovação são necessários. Entre as opções a seguir, () é verificado pelo teste
A. Se o teste de software fez algo que não deveria ser feito
B. Estimativa errada Resultados
C. Dados aleatórios terão resultados
D. Se o sistema de software e os requisitos são consistentes

16. A fábrica vende produtos A, a quantidade do pedido é de 80 yuans por peça dentro de um determinado padrão e cada peça que excede o padrão pode desfrutar de um desconto de 10%. O Wumart Mall comprou 170 peças de produtos A e pagou 13.200 yuan. O padrão especificado pela fábrica é () peças
A.112
B.120
C.108
D.96

17. Existem diferenças na classificação dos endereços IPv6 e IPv4. Os seguintes tipos não pertencem aos endereços IPv6 são ()
A. Endereço de broadcast
B. Endereço Anycast
C. Endereço Unicast
D. Endereço Multicast

18. O gerenciamento de memória se refere ao mecanismo de como o sistema operacional aloca e recupera memória. Então, o que há de errado com a alocação de memória na pilha no gerenciamento de memória do sistema operacional é que
A. A pilha é alocada automaticamente pelo sistema, o que é mais rápido, mas o programador pode controlá-la.
B. Se os dados definidos excederem o espaço da pilha, o programa irá estourar Para travamentos, o compilador não é responsável pela verificação, portanto, dados de grande capacidade não devem ser alocados na pilha.
C. O heap exige que o programador se inscreva e especifique o tamanho
D. A pilha é gerenciada pelo processo, o tamanho é relativamente fixo e a escala é pequena. Uma vez que o sistema operacional Depois que a pilha é alocada para o programa, ela é ignorada e o sistema operacional a vê como parte do processo.

19. Na Internet, o protocolo da camada de aplicação é conectado através do protocolo da camada de transporte.O seguinte protocolo da camada de aplicação conectado através do protocolo TCP é ()
A.tftp
B.ftp
C.dhcp
D.bootp

Às 20h10, A e B estão caminhando em direção um ao outro ao mesmo tempo de A e B, que estão separados por 72 quilômetros. A velocidade de A é de 10 quilômetros / hora e a de B é de 8 quilômetros / hora. Depois de se encontrarem, A e B se encontrarão cada um Continue a
avançar na metade da velocidade original, o tempo para A alcançar B é () A.17: 12
B.20: 24 C.20
: 40
D.22:

Acho que você gosta

Origin blog.csdn.net/qq_34124009/article/details/108192777
Recomendado
Clasificación